Mohamed Salah has scored 22 goals for Liverpool in the Premier League, a tally that puts him level with Harry Kane in the race for the Golden Boot, and whoever finishes top will follow Thierry Henry and Alan Shearer as the only three-time winners.

On the pitch, Salah has frequently had to keep Liverpool’s challenge single-handedly. He is the only player to have touched double figures for goals in the Premier League due to the deviation of Sadio Mane and Roberto Firmino.

On Sunday, Liverpool will secure finishing in the top four if they defeated Crystal Palace at Anfield and Leicester don’t win by at least five against Tottenham. Even then, Liverpool will make it if Chelsea fails to triumph at Aston Villa.

However, this reckoning won’t be essential should Salah step up to the plate again.

“For a striker to have those numbers in a team which is not flying constantly, it is absolutely exceptional,”said a grateful Klopp.

“It’s clear that Mo carries a lot even though we know the team also help him. It’s his desire and professionalism. It’s his greed as well which helps us completely.

“This year is one of his best even if he scored more in another season. It’s easy to see where we would be without Mo’s goals. That’s what makes him really special.’

This season has been different for Klopp. Beforehand, everything he laid hands after arriving from Dortmund turned to gold. He took Liverpool to a Europa League final in his first campaign, Champions League finals in his next two and then ended Liverpool’s 30-year wait for the league title in 2020. It’s been far difficult this time on and off the pitch. When his mother died in Germany, he was unable to attend the funeral.

“It has been the most difficult year of my life,”he admitted.
“I never thought I would have to deal with the pandemic; not just for me personally, but for us all. I found that really difficult to deal with at times, to be honest. Football was part of it.

“What did I learn? That sleep is overestimated. And am I a better manager? Better, I am not sure but much more experienced.

“No day is like the one before, always new problems, always something else. There will be a time when I appreciate that but it will be in the future, not in the moment.’

Interestingly, Liverpool have not been named in the list of clubs that would be involved in an auction for Kane. It’s a position that owners FSG have been financially harmed by the pandemic and if they are to one day make a statement signing, as they did with Van Dijk, the target would be PSG’s Kylian Mbappe.

Should all his injured players recover next season, Klopp’s squad immediately looks more robust. But they are set to lose Gini Wijnaldum who is at the end of his deal after playing an outstanding in Liverpool’s progress over the last few years.

“I am happy with my squad. Could it improve? Yes, like any squad. Is that affordable? I don’t know. Is it necessary? I don’t know,” said Klopp diplomatically.

“The most important thing is to be able to be a really uncomfortable opponent. We might not be the best team in the world at the start of the season but we want to again be the team nobody wants to play against because we are that good.

“I really think it’s my responsibility to improve the team without signings.”
